#fabd85 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fabd85 is composed of 98% red, 74.1%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.4% magenta, 46.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 28.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 75.1%. #fabd85 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f57b0b.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#fabd85

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0500 is the darkest color, while #fffa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fabd85

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4bfbb is the less saturated color, while #ffbd80 is the most saturated one.
